[发明专利]客户端-服务器输入法编辑器体系结构有效
申请号: | 201080062456.0 | 申请日: | 2010-11-24 |
公开(公告)号: | CN102834819A | 公开(公告)日: | 2012-12-19 |
发明(设计)人: | 波村大悟;小松弘幸;向井淳;工藤拓;及川卓也;花冈俊行;松田靖广;汤川洋平;田畑悠介 | 申请(专利权)人: | 谷歌公司 |
主分类号: | G06F15/16 | 分类号: | G06F15/16;G06F15/17;H04L29/06 |
代理公司: | 中原信达知识产权代理有限责任公司 11219 | 代理人: | 周亚荣;安翔 |
地址: | 美国加利*** | 国省代码: | 美国;US |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 客户端 服务器 输入法 编辑器 体系结构 | ||
相关申请的交叉引用
本申请要求于2009年11月27日提交的美国申请No.61/264,714的优先权,将其公开内容以全文引用方式明确并入本文中。
技术领域
本公开涉及输入法编辑器。
背景技术
使用语标文字(script)的语言,其中一个或两个字符大致上对应于一个词或含义,具有比诸如计算机键盘或移动设备键区的标准输入设备上的键多的字符。例如,日语在片假名和平假名两者中包含数百个字符。这些潜在多对一关联的映射可以由便于在输入设备上未找到的字符和符号的输入的输入法编辑器来实现。因此,可以使用西式键盘来输入日语字符。同样地,可以使用用于以下的输入法:使用西式键盘或一些其他输入设备来输入包括表意符号的许多其他语言,诸如中文、韩语和其他语言。
为了实现输入法,用户典型地必须安装客户端软件应用程序和库。然而,当用户正在不属于该用户的计算机设备——例如公共计算机设备或工作环境中的第二计算机等——上工作时,这样的安装可能是不方便的。此外,客户端软件应用程序可能是存储器和处理器密集的,因此对客户端来说是累赘的,以及可能是依赖于语言的,对于每一个期望的语言都需要应用程序。
发明内容
本说明书描述了与输入法编辑器,以及尤其具有客户端-服务器体系结构的输入法编辑器有关的技术。
总的来说,在本说明书中描述的主题的一个有创新性的方面可以在包括以下动作的方法中具体化:接收输入法编辑器(IME)服务器请求,IME服务器请求包括一个或多个令牌并且请求IME服务器被实例化,IME服务器基于发送自IME客户端的键事件来执行一个或多个IME功能,其中IME服务器是存储在IME服务器和IME客户端之间的通信会话的请求和响应两者的有状态服务器;基于一个或多个令牌来确定IME服务器可以在限制环境中被实例化;以及在限制环境中实例化IME服务器。本方面的其他实施例包括被配置成执行该方法的动作、编码在计算机存储设备上的对应系统、装置和计算机程序。
总的来说,在本说明书中描述的主题的另一个方面可以在包括以下动作的方法中具体化:接收输入法编辑器(IME)服务器请求,IME服务器请求包括一个或多个令牌并且请求IME服务器被实例化,IME服务器基于发送自IME客户端的键事件来执行一个或多个IME功能,其中IME服务器是存储在IME服务器和IME客户端之间的通信会话的请求和响应两者的有状态服务器;对一个或多个令牌进行处理;基于该处理来确定IME服务器可以被实例化;在限制环境中实例化IME服务器,限制环境限制IME服务器的功能;确定IME服务器没有正在限制环境中执行;以及响应于该确定而停止IME服务器。本方面的其他实施例包括被配置成执行该方法的动作、编码在计算机存储设备上的对应系统、装置和计算机程序。
总的来说,在本说明书中描述的主题的另一个方面可以在包括以下动作的方法中具体化:建立在第一输入法编辑器(IME)客户端和第一IME服务器之间的第一会话;请求在第二IME客户端和第一服务器之间的第二会话;确定第一IME服务器的版本不同于第二IME客户端的版本;响应于确定第一IME服务器的版本不同于第二IME客户端的版本,停止第一服务器;以及实例化第二IME服务器,第二IME服务器具有与第二客户端的版本相同的版本。本方面的其他实施例包括被配置成执行该方法的动作、编码在计算机存储设备上的对应系统、装置和计算机程序。
总的来说,在本说明书中描述的主题的另一个方面可以在包括以下动作的方法中具体化:建立在第一输入法编辑器(IME)客户端和第一IME服务器之间的第一会话;请求在第二IME客户端和第一IME服务器之间的第二会话;确定第一IME服务器的版本与第二IME客户端的版本相同;响应于该确定,建立在第二IME客户端和第一IME服务器之间的第二会话;以及执行第一会话和第二会话。本方面的其他实施例包括被配置成执行该方法的动作、编码在计算机存储设备上的对应系统、装置和计算机程序。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于谷歌公司,未经谷歌公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201080062456.0/2.html,转载请声明来源钻瓜专利网。